L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 945|回复: 3

请问我这样编译内核对吗?(内)(solved)

[复制链接]
发表于 2008-2-2 20:10:14 | 显示全部楼层 |阅读模式
各位:
我现在都是这样编译内核的。
1. cd  /usr/src/linux
2. make menuconfig
3. make && make modules_install
4. cp arch/i386/boot/bzImage /boot/kernel/linux-2.6.23-gentoo-r3
5. cp System.map /boot/System.map-2.6.23-gentoo-r3

我在/boot 下面看到这两个文件:
vmlinuz-2.6.23-gentoo-r3,config-2.6.23-gentoo-r3
请问这两个文件是作什么用的?我重新编译内核,这两个文件需要更新吗?
我上面编译内核的步骤正确吗?

谢谢!!~~
发表于 2008-2-2 20:24:07 | 显示全部楼层
3、4、5步用make && make install modules_install 即可。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-2-2 20:47:04 | 显示全部楼层
那我在问一下。make install是自动把内核拷贝成/boot/下面的哪一个文件呢?
我在grub.conf中把以前的/boot/kernel/linux-2.6.23-gentoo-r3 换成了/boot/kernel/vmlinuz-2.6.23-gentoo-r3.那么/boot/kernel/linux-2.6.23-gentoo-r3是不是就可以删除了?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2008-2-2 20:56:05 | 显示全部楼层
我刚刚实验了一下,make install 后,会update /boot directory.
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表